Re: A single savefile is not appearing in-game anymore

@CyanideBread ver0-4 are backups, the game can't read those unless you use the recover function.

It's best if you move everything out and put the ones that are just called Slot_xxxxxxxx.save (xxxxxxxx being a 8 digit hexnumber) back. Those are the only ones the game will recognize.

Count how many you have and how many show up and check by hovering over the folder icon which one is missing.

  • Okay, something very strange has just happened.

    Good thing is: my dissappeared world has just come back when I opened Sims to check the file path. I have no idea why, as I haven't done anything.

    Bad thing is: now my second-most played household has dissappeared. It's the save called "Slot_0000000f.save", and it's file seems to have changed from '.save' to '.save.tmp' (a tmp-file) for some reason.

  • Okay, so I safe-copied the .tmp-file and changed the file from .tmp to .save and loaded Sims, and both worlds are now back.

    I have no idea how, but now both the original and the new problem is gone. Both worlds are working and I can play them just fine.
